It appeared in 1969 with a long nose, short deck 2-door coupe style and was equipped with an inline 6-cylinder 2-liter or 2.4-liter engine. It was popular not only in Japan but also in America, where it was called the Z-car. In 1978, it underwent a full model change to the second generation. The body design retained the popular long-nose, short-deck style, and the engine options included a 2-liter inline 6-cylinder and a larger 2.8-liter. From the 1980 model year, a T-bar roof version with a removable roof was also added to the lineup. Furthermore, in 1982, a turbocharged version of the engine was introduced. While only the 2-liter engine was available in Japan, in America, a turbocharged version was also added to the 2.8-liter model, further enhancing its performance.
